Calculates the density-independent rate of total egg production
R_{di} (units 1/year) before density dependence, by species.
You would not usually call this
function directly but instead use getRDI(), which then calls this
function unless an alternative function has been registered, see below.

This rate is obtained by taking the per capita rate E_r(w)\psi(w) at
which energy is invested in reproduction, as calculated by getERepro(),
multiplying it by the number of individualsN(w) and integrating over
all sizes w and then multiplying by the reproductive efficiency
\epsilon and dividing by the egg size w_min, and by a factor of two
to account for the two sexes:
R_{di} = \frac{\epsilon}{2 w_{min}} \int N(w) E_r(w) \psi(w) \, dw
Used by getRDD() to calculate the actual, density dependent rate.
See setReproduction() for more details.
A numeric vector with the rate of egg production for each species.
By default getRDI() calls mizerRDI(). However you can
replace this with your own alternative reproduction function. If
your function is called "myRDI" then you register it in a MizerParams
object params with
params <- setRateFunction(params, "RDI", "myRDI")
Your function will then be called instead of mizerRDI(), with the
same arguments. For an example of an alternative reproduction function
see constantEggRDI().
